GLOBAL EMISSIONS AGREEMENT IS ACHIEVABLE - HUHNE

2.35.00pm GMT Fri 16th Mar 2007

Commenting ahead of today's meeting of G8 environment ministers in Germany, Liberal Democrat Shadow Environment Secretary, Chris Huhne MP said:

"The initiative that Germany has taken to put climate change at the centre of its work in the EU and the G8 is just what is needed to capitalise on the big shift in global public opinion.

"It is also very welcome that the big players among the developing countries are participating.

"One reason for optimism about talks at global level is that 80 per cent of carbon emissions are accounted for by just 20 countries. It really is possible to crack the bulk of the problem with an agreement between a few key leaders gathered together in one room."
